The year marks both the 70th anniversary of the Nuremberg Code and the first major revisions of federal research regulations in almost 3 decades. I suggest that the informed consent provisions of the federal research regulations continue to follow the requirements of the Nuremberg Code. However, modifications are needed to the informed consent and institutional review board provisions to make the revised federal regulations more effective in promoting a genuine conversation between the researcher and the research subject.
This conversation must take seriously both the therapeutic illusion and the desire of both the researcher and the research subject not to engage in sharing uncertainty. The Nuremberg Code set the standard for every subsequent attempt to regulate human experimentation.
Its first principle remains, 70 years later, its most important: the requirement of the voluntary, competent, informed, and understanding consent of the human subject. Anniversaries provide an opportunity to reflect and to explore how subsequent events and discussions have affected our understanding of critical documents like the Nuremberg Code.
The Code was a product of a war crimes trial, and a summary version of the Code was quickly adopted as an explicit requirement of the Geneva Conventions of and the International Covenant on Civil and Political Rights ICCPR in ; it is a norm of customary international law.
It has been 70 years since the Nuremberg Code was authored, and federal research regulations are, in , receiving their first major revision in almost 30 years. The consent provisions of the revised federal research regulations follow the requirements promulgated by the Nuremberg Code.
